HIV on the rise in Belgaum

Photo of author

The report prepared by the district health department shows that a large number of persons have tested positive for HIV in the district and the prevalence rate was on the rise in an alarming manner. The number of people who have tested positive since January 2002 until July 2008 is 13,548. Of this, 10,601 tested positive from 2002 to 2007. During this year until the end of July, 2,947 persons have tested positive to the dreaded disease.

There is a phenomenal increase in the number of people afflicted by HIV/AIDS since 2002 when only 75 persons were tested positive among the 593 counselled and 477 taking up the tests. In 2003, 4,011 persons were counselled, of whom 2,946 were tested and 644 were found positive. Similarly in 2004, 13,609 were counselled, 12,030 underwent the test of which 1,105 were found positive. The figure shot up further in 2005 when 20,862 persons were counseled, 18,156 were tested and 1,728 were found positive.

In 2006, 29,112 persons were counselled and 23,377 were tested of which 2,059 were found positive. In 2007, the figures inflated as 40,105 persons were counseled, 35,353 were tested and 3,990 were found positive.
